A brand which got my attention was Zenith. Their Pilot watches offer some great pieces for a VERY acceptable price. Compared to IWC, JLC and other competitors I would say they are damn cheap
Anyway, to promote their pilot series they made a very special watch.
The Montre d'Aéronef type 20
And the more I look at it or read about it, the more I love it
The most important might be the movement. This 5011K is a very special movement for Zenith. It was made in the 1950's / 1960's and was the most accurate movement at that time. In 1967 it was named the most accurate chronometer ever tested by the Neuchatel Observatory. And probably it still holds this record
The movement was made for Marine deck clocks and Pocket watches. The movement is big .... 50 mm
So yes, the watch has to be big too and 57.5 is big. For some it is to big to wear but
such a piece of history is imo a must have.
